Output 95caf5a654f806c6626f8400af48e2f25a54ddc1115e7da708dbe56a45084700:3

value
99900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02673b6e5c6f947e6a106b2bbd00550cec67f151 OP_EQUAL
address
31uiwd6UAYTU2pRpj2x2trZ3LvqWqBFq87
transaction
95caf5a654f806c6626f8400af48e2f25a54ddc1115e7da708dbe56a45084700
spent
true